Hanna-Barbera’s animated version of The Addams Family sitcom debuted in September of 1973 and 16 episodes were produced. Voice actors for the series included Ted Cassidy, Jackie Coogan, Janet Waldo, Lennie (H.R. Pufnstuf) Weinrib and Jodie Foster (as Pugsly). Enjoy … Continue reading

Television and film icon Andy Griffith has died at the age of 86 at his home in North Carolina. Griffith was best known for playing sheriff Andy Taylor on The Andy Griffith Show (1960-68) and defense attorney Matlock (1986-1995). During … Continue reading
